Transaction 26095759363391873fe211624d6b5c982d61fa72ae1a74a6207952bccce50c0d

3 Input
2 Outputs
  • 26095759363391873fe211624d6b5c982d61fa72ae1a74a6207952bccce50c0d:0
  • value  2017273
    address  1AA649Q9E6f6Sy7d3xBF1A7mfVm1NUwf3N
  • 26095759363391873fe211624d6b5c982d61fa72ae1a74a6207952bccce50c0d:1
  • value  210261
    address  1JK9Kmcs68HoSpPkcrveKnFnrzcgTtumZt